Mohanbhai Kalyanjibhai Kundariya (born 6 September 1951) is an Indian politician and a former Union Minister of State for Agriculture and Farmer Welfare in the Government of India. He was also elected to Gujarat Legislative Assembly from Tankara assembly constituency of Rajkot district.[1]

He served as Minister of State from May 2014 to 5 July 2016.[2]

Twelve of Kundariya's family members, including his sister, were killed during the 2022 Morbi bridge collapse.[3]
